How to Score Your First Tech Coach Position

Getting Qualified for the Interview
  • What makes you qualified to become a Tech Coach?
    • Reflect upon and own your strengths; don’t be afraid to tout your knowledge with back information of how your knowledge can help others.
    • Remember just because you are a “tech geek”, it doesn’t always make you a good tech coach. A good tech coach needs to be able to talk the tech talk, but also talk the talk at the level of the teacher/user/beginner, etc.
  • Are EdTech Badges necessary?
  • Should you look to get out of the classroom?
    • Reflection - Know your WHY!  Why are you really wanting a position like this, make sure you have motivation driving you and not burn out or frustration driving you away from something else!
